A Fascinating Adventure Across The ages: The Background of Bobbleheads

The origin of bobbleheads is grounded in old epochs, tracked back to more than two thousand years ago. Despite their current popularity, it’s very amazing to understand that bobbleheads have survived during ages of cultural alteration.

In early China and Japan’s, the earliest known bobblehead-like forms were created. Such were commonly crafted from flexible bamboo’s strips and represented popular spiritual and ideological figures. While such early models did not embody the humour and pop culture mentions we see today, they did have in common a mutual designing feature – an enormous cranium, reacting to movement with a distinct nodding action – custom bobbleheads.

Fast forward to the 18th century, bobbleheads had identified their route into European lifestyle, with Germany leading the bobblehead trend. In here, such figures were known as as “nodders”. Made from ceramic’s substances, nodders regularly portrayed creatures or human forms and were famous home and garden’s ornaments. The nodder fashion spread out to Russia’s, which gave rise to the famous ‘nevalyashka’ or the ‘roly-poly toy’ made of wood’s.

The contemporary bobblehead, comparable to what we are acquainted with currently, took form in America in the 1960s. Initially, these were sports forms, awarded to spectators as promotional objects during baseball contests. The novel and involving idea was a blast, leading to the development of bobbleheads to include a vast array of characters and shapes, from celebrities to fictional personalities, and more.

From the Concept to Collectible: The Creating of a Bobblehead

The making of a bobblehead is a blend of artistic’s idea and detailed workmanship. Each bobblehead commences as a idea, defined by the position, clothing and face’s gesture the figure will wear. Artists use these kind of criteria to sketch the design beforehand moving on to the carving stage.

Traditionally, the sculpture or model is handcrafted from clay’s or wax’s. This arduous procedure involves careful detailing to guarantee that the final product is a ideal manifestation of the initial’s idea. The prototype serves as the plan for making a mold’s, which is then utilized for mass’s creation.

The material’s utilized to craft the bobblehead changes based on on the plan and objective of the figure. Resin’s, due to its durability’s and molding ease, is the most frequently used substance. However, other substances such as plastic, ceramic’s, and even wood’s are also used. The single parts are cast from the mold’s, cleaned, and then hand-painted to add deepness and life’s to the character’s.

The defining’s feature of a bobblehead is the spring mechanism that connects the head’s to the body’s, facilitating the typical oscillating motion’s. The spring’s is thoroughly designed to balance the head’s motion – it shouldn’t be too loose to make the head excessively moveable, nor too tight to limit the bobbing motion’s – bobbleheads bulk.

A Gathering Phenomenon: Bobbleheads as Assets

It’s noteworthy that bobbleheads aren’t just toys or souvenirs. To some, they symbolize serious commerce and capital opportunities. Over the years, certain vintage and limited-edition bobbleheads have significantly swelled in worth, sought after by ardent gatherers worldwide.

Take the 1960s-era bobbleheads of baseball players from the Major League, for instance. These statues, first handed out as promotional goods, are now treasured collectibles that obtain hundreds, even thousands of of dollars at sales. Similarly, wobblers depicting scarce characters or those produced in limited quantities can become surprisingly valuable over time. Such economic potential has turned many bobblehead enthusiasts into knowledgeable enthusiasts, constantly on the search for the next valuable piece.
